Job responsibilities

The people advisor is responsible for providing highquality people services support to both employees and line managers withintheir designated service areas. The post holder will be required work flexibly,including travel to other sites when required, and collaborate with othercolleagues in the people services team, including proactively identifying areasfor service improvement.

Keyduties and responsibilities include:

  • Provide excellent advice and guidance to employees and line managers on day-to-day HR issues in line with company policies and procedures.
  • Be the first point ofcontact for all employee relations issues, including disciplinary, grievance andperformance. This will include advising on the process, attending and takingnotes at meetings and ensuring that consistent outcomes are given at all meetingswhere possible.
  • Supportmanagers to effectively manage sickness absence cases by advising andsupporting in accordance with absence management policies and the Equality Act,liaising as appropriate with Occupational Health and attending meetings asrequired.
  • Supportingservice restructures and TUPE processes, including managing consultation processes,changing terms and conditions, and redundancy, in accordance with policy andemployment legislation.
  • Responding to high volume queriesand case management, responsible for personal time management and allocation oftime correctly.
  • Attending regular managementmeetings, providing accurate and timely HR data to inform people processes.
  • Conduct exit interviews andwith the people business partners, use collected data to inform retentioninitiatives and strategies involving the wider HR team.
  • Support the recruitment teamwith recruitment processes as required, including attending interviews.
  • Ensure maternity, paternityand adoption cases are managed effectively, employees are informed of theirentitlements. Work with the administrators to ensure payroll are informed.
  • Liaise with the people administratorsto ensure sickness absence cases are captured and managed in line with Companypolicy.
  • Supervise the work of the peopleadministrators, including being the first point of escalation for work-relatedissues.
  • Assist and input into the work ofthe people services team as a whole, including ensuring people records aremaintained, and appropriate systems are developed in order to provide a range ofregular management reports.
  • Support the people businesspartners in conducting monthly KPI reporting and providing accurate data to thebusiness.
  • Beresponsible for centralised recording and reporting on employee data, such asCovid-19 absences, Covid-19 and flu vaccination records, etc.
  • Takingan active part in introducing, reviewing, and/or carrying out employee engagement/wellbeingprojects and initiatives.
  • Act asthe super user for iTrent, developing system structures, etc. where required.This includes providing support to the people administrators in completingpayroll changes and updates to the system.
  • Support the head of people servicesand people business partners in updating, and introducing, HR policies &procedures in line with employment legislation.
  • Supporting the creation anddelivery of training to be provided as required in line with organisationalneed.
  • Support and assist the headof people services and wider business colleagues with a range of projects andinitiatives as required.
  • Keepabreast of developments in employment legislation and case law.
  • Promote Equality and Diversityas part of the culture of the organisation.
  • Support GDPR complianceby ensuring employee data is processed in line with regulations, and disposedof accordingly.
  • Undertakeany other reasonable tasks as directed from time to time by the head of people services.
Person Specification Qualifications
  • Minimum of 5 c grade GCSEs including Maths and English or equivalent.
  • CIPD qualification or similar
  • Driving licence
Skills and attributes
  • Highly organised, able to prioritise a demanding workload and conflicting deadlines, remaining efficient under pressure and flexible to unexpected demands.
  • Understanding of Employment Law principles and how to consider and apply these in HR practices.
  • Ability to work as part of a team and on own initiative.
  • Ability to maintain confidentiality.
  • Reliable and punctual.
  • Ability to liaise with professionals at all levels in a confident and effective manner.
  • Personable and able to be empathetic in difficult situations.
  • Attention to detail with good oral and written communication skills.
Experience
  • Working with HR systems i.e. iTrent.
  • Confident advising on HR policies and processes.
  • Management of employee relations cases from start to finish.
  • Managing difficult conversations and conflict resolution.
  • Understanding of payroll processes and timeframes.
  • Understanding of employee contracts and requirements.
  • Supporting organisational change processes such a TUPE, restructure and redundancy.
  • Extensive knowledge of Microsoft Office applications.
  • Experience of generating reports for use by senior management teams.
